截至目前(2024年中),Windows Server 2025 尚未正式发布,但基于 Windows Server 的长期发展规律和 Windows Server 2022 的功能,我们可以合理推测其安装和配置方式与前代版本类似。如果你正在使用 Windows Server 2025 的预览版或技术预览版本,并且安装的是 Server Core(命令行界面) 版本,想要添加 GUI(图形用户界面),可以使用以下方法。
✅ 在 Windows Server 2025(Server Core)上安装 GUI 界面
方法:使用 DISM 和 PowerShell 安装桌面体验功能
-
以管理员身份打开 PowerShell
-
检查当前安装的版本和可用功能
Get-WindowsEdition -Online确保你当前的版本支持 GUI(如 Standard 或 Datacenter 版本)。
-
查看可安装的 GUI 功能
Get-WindowsFeature | Where-Object { $_.Name -like "*GUI*" -or $_.Name -like "*Desktop*" }常见相关功能包括:
Server-Gui-Mgmt-Infra:图形化管理工具Server-Gui-Shell:桌面外壳(完整的 GUI)Desktop-Experience:完整桌面体验(包括主题、多媒体等)
-
安装 GUI 组件
Install-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art⚠️ 注意:安装
Server-Gui-Shell是启用完整图形界面的关键,安装后系统将重启。 -
(可选)安装完整桌面体验
Install-WindowsFeature Desktop-Experience -Restart这会添加更多如 Windows 资源管理器、主题、音效等桌面功能。
🔄 转换为 Server with Desktop Experience
上述操作会将 Server Core 转换为 Server with Desktop Experience 模式(即带 GUI 的完整模式)。
💡 提示:这种转换是可逆的,也可以通过卸载这些功能回到 Server Core。
❌ 常见问题与注意事项
- 许可证要求:确保你的 Windows Server 2025 许可证支持 GUI 模式。
- 磁盘空间:GUI 功能需要额外 5-10 GB 空间。
- 性能影响:GUI 会增加资源占用,生产环境建议使用 Core 模式 + 远程管理。
- 远程管理替代方案:推荐使用 Windows Admin Center 或 PowerShell Remoting,避免在服务器上启用 GUI。
🛠️ 验证安装结果
安装并重启后,运行:
Get-WindowsFeature | Where-Object Installed | Select Name
确认 Server-Gui-Mgmt-Infra 和 Server-Gui-Shell 已安装。
你也可以通过远程桌面(RDP)连接服务器,查看是否进入图形界面。
🔁 反向操作:从 GUI 回到 Core
如果以后想移除 GUI:
Uninstall-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art
总结
| 操作 | 命令 |
|---|---|
| 安装 GUI 管理工具和外壳 | Install-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art |
| 安装完整桌面体验 | Install-WindowsFeature Desktop-Experience -Restart |
| 卸载 GUI 回到 Core | Uninstall-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art |
✅ 建议:除非必要(如运行特定 GUI 应用),否则建议保持 Server Core 模式,更安全、轻量、稳定。
如你使用的是特定版本(如 Insider Preview),命令可能略有不同,欢迎提供具体版本号以便进一步指导。
秒懂云